Let's do what we can to get https://github.com/openSUSE/fuel-ignition running as ignite.opensuse.org respectively ignite-stage.opensuse.org

Project Description

Ignition and combustion are currently one of top picks for first-boot configuration used in MicrOS, SLE Micro, Leap Micro etc ... We'd like to have fuel-ignition, a client-side generator of ignition USB images hosted as ignite-stage.opensuse.org and optionally ignite.opensuse.org if we can make it. opensuse-heroes ticket is here https://progress.opensuse.org/issues/111452

This especially help new users, who might struggle with the new way to deploy images. See https://www.youtube.com/watch?v=ft8UVx9elKc

Goal for this Hackweek

Resources

  • Somebody who wants to build container for the first time
  • Somebody from openSUSE heroes to help deploy it and do port forwarding from e.g. 3000 in container to 80 on host poo#111452

Looking for hackers with the skills:

heroes containers ignition combustion opensuseheroes opensuse nodejs

This project is part of:

Hack Week 21

Activity

  • almost 2 years ago: malcolmlewis joined this project.
  • almost 2 years ago: jzerebecki liked this project.
  • almost 2 years ago: dgedon liked this project.
  • almost 2 years ago: lkocman added keyword "nodejs" to this project.
  • almost 2 years ago: lkocman started this project.
  • almost 2 years ago: lkocman added keyword "heroes" to this project.
  • almost 2 years ago: lkocman added keyword "containers" to this project.
  • almost 2 years ago: lkocman added keyword "ignition" to this project.
  • almost 2 years ago: lkocman added keyword "combustion" to this project.
  • almost 2 years ago: lkocman added keyword "opensuseheroes" to this project.
  • almost 2 years ago: lkocman added keyword "opensuse" to this project.
  • almost 2 years ago: lkocman originated this project.

  • Comments

    • malcolmlewis
      almost 2 years ago by malcolmlewis | Reply

      @lkocman Hi, I'm not sure of the process here add-emoji I can liaise with the Heroes folks to set up the OBS container if needed?

    • malcolmlewis
      almost 2 years ago by malcolmlewis | Reply

      It seems to me the container setup is needed on openSUSE:infrastructure first, then can branch and work on the container build?

    • malcolmlewis
      almost 2 years ago by malcolmlewis | Reply

      Hi So trying to build a container is umm frustrating add-emoji

      Following this: https://openbuildservice.org/help/manuals/obs-user-guide/cha.obs.build_containers.html

      And searching here for nodejs https://registry.opensuse.org/cgi-bin/cooverview?srch_term=project%3D%5E%28%3F%21%28open%29%3FSUSE%3A%7Ckubic%3A%7Chome%3A%29

      I expected the following to work on OBS?

      FROM devel/bci/sle-15-sp3/images/bci/nodejs
      

      Changed from;

      FROM registry.suse.com/bci/nodejs
      

      Or is there another way to pull nodejs from the Dockerfile or another container?

    Similar Projects

    Exploring DPDK within containers by paolodepa

    Project Description

    Containerization is h...


    Containerized home mirror by lkocman

    I'm running a simple home mirror, but I managed...


    Forklift - Text based GUI utility for dealing with containers by andreabenini

    [comment]: # (Please use the project descriptio...


    Predefined app security policy template for NeuVector by feih

    Project Description

    Idea is to predefin...


    A set of utilities to produce a "from scratch" OCI/Docker container using Opensuse/SLE rpms by ldragon

    [comment]: # (Please use the project descriptio...


    Generate ignition/combustion files from Uyuni/SUSE Manager by dvosburg

    [comment]: # (Please use the project descriptio...


    Generate ignition/combustion files from Uyuni/SUSE Manager by dvosburg

    [comment]: # (Please use the project descriptio...


    Containerized home mirror by lkocman

    I'm running a simple home mirror, but I managed...


    Investigate zypper/openSUSE repository refresh optimisations by dirkmueller

    [comment]: # (Please use the project descriptio...


    Basic calendar interface for upcoming openSUSE meetings by lkocman

    [comment]: # (Please use the project descriptio...


    Apple Silicon openSUSE spin by vgrinco

    Project Description

    The folks at [Asahi lin...


    Update Haskell ecosystem in Tumbleweed to GHC-9.6.x by psimons

    [comment]: # (Please use the project descriptio...


    A command line image collector tool for my gallery website by AZhou

    [comment]: # (Please use the project descriptio...